M

- Set SRQ Mask

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

TYPE

System

 

 

 

 

 

 

EXECUTION

Deferred

 

 

 

 

 

 

SYNTAX

Mmask

Use the IEEE 488 Service Request (SRQ) mechanism to inform the

 

 

 

IEEE 488 bus controller of certain conditions, where mask is in the form of

 

 

 

the number nnn such that 000 < nnn < 255 is summed from the

 

 

 

following conditions:

 

 

 

 

 

 

000

- Power-on default mask value

008

- SRQ On Scan Available

 

 

 

001

- SRQ On Alarm

016

- SRQ On Message Available

 

 

 

002

- SRQ On Trigger Event

032

- SRQ On Event Detected

 

 

 

004

- SRQ On Ready

128

- SRQ On Buffer Overrun

 

 

M?

Query the SRQ mask.

 

 

 

 

DESCRIPTION

 

 

 

 

 

 

The Set SRQ Mask (M) command uses the IEEE 488 Service Request (SRQ) mechanism to inform the IEEE 488 bus controller of the existence of several conditions in the Service Request Enable (SRE) Register. These conditions are described in detail below. Multiple conditions can be enabled simultaneously. If multiple conditions are contained within the same command string, each Set SRQ Mask command should be proceeded by an Execute (X) command. The resulting SRQ Mask register value is the logical ORed value of the individual values sent. Alternately, the entire value of all the desired conditions may be sent within one Set SRQ Mask (M) command string. The programmed SRQ Mask remains enabled until the receipt of a M000 command or the detection of a Device Clear (DCL) or Selected Device Clear (SDC).

The following list outlines the possible conditions of the SRE:

M000: This is the power-on default mask value. It disables the unit from generating service requests by clearing the entire mask of the Service Request Enable (SRE) Register to zero.

M001: SRQ On Alarm. Sending this command will enable the unit to generate an SRQ when it has recognized that one or more channels has gone into alarm condition. Refer to the Configure Channels (C) command on how to configure an alarm condition.

M002: SRQ On Trigger Event. Sending this command allows the unit to generate a service request when it has detected a valid trigger from the programmed trigger source.

M004: SRQ On Ready. This command causes a service request to be generated when the unit has completed executing a set of commands from the IEEE 488 bus controller. This is used to allow the bus controller to attend to other bus matters while the unit is changing its internal state.

M008: SRQ On Scan Available. Sending this command will cause the unit to generate an SRQ when at least one scan is available to be read in the acquisition buffer.

M016: SRQ On Message Available (MAV). Sending this command will cause the unit to generate an SRQ when there is data available in the output queue to be read.

M032: SRQ On Event Detected. Sending this command will cause the unit to generate an SRQ when at least one of the defined events in the Event Status Register has occurred. Refer to the Set Event Mask (N) command on how to define events.

M128: SRQ On Buffer Overrun. Sending this command will cause the unit to generate an SRQ when it has detected that an overrun of the acquisition buffer has occurred.

EXAMPLE

PRINT#1,“OUTPUT07;M0X”

‘ Clear the Service Request Enable (SRE) register

PRINT#1,“OUTPUT07;M1XM2X”

‘ Set the unit to SRQ on Alarm or Trigger

PRINT#1,“OUTPUT07;M?X”

‘ Read the current Service Request Enable (SRE)

 

register

PRINT#1,“ENTER07"

‘ Computer screen shows M003

LINE INPUT #2, M$

 

PRINT M$
